Last week we learned that EAT Restaurant Partners were looking at the former Stronghill space to house their fifth restaurant location. Richmond.com confirmed that they will transform the space into Fat Dragon Chinese Kitchen and Bar, a Chinese twist on farm-to-table dining. According to West of the Boulevard News, EAT Restaurant Partners will host a logo design competition for the new restaurant, which is the same way they came up with the Blue Goat and Wild Ginger logos.

In restaurant closing news, Sensi has shut its doors. The Shockoe Bottom restaurant opened in 2005 and specialized in modern Italian fare. The website and Facebook page are still active but the doors are locked, lights are off, and the phone is disconnected.

According to Style Weekly, Richmond’s famous Szechuan chef, Peter Chang, has been looking downtown for possible expansion locations. Crispy fried eggplant available in the city? Yes, please!

Back in February, 525 at the Berry Burke started the process of bringing another dining option to the Centerstage area of downtown. It looks like they are now officially open. Head Chef Taylor Hasty is serving up new American cuisine at the corner of 6th and West Grace. You can now view lunch, dinner, dessert, and cocktail menus. Hours are:

  • Monday – Thursday 11am to 11pm
  • Friday and Saturday 11am to “late night”
  • Sunday brunch 11am to 3pm
  • Sunday dinner 4pm to 9pm.

This Saturday marks the 10th anniversary of the Vegetarian Festival. Head over to the Azalea Gardens in Bryan Park between 12:00 – 6:00 PM for over 30 vendors serving up delicious vegetarian fare. The festival is free, but bring a can of food to donate to the Lamb Basket, an emergency food pantry located in Lakeside serving Henrico. Tricycle Gardens will also be at the festival collecting donations.

Next Thursday, June 28th, Shula’s American Steakhouse will be hosting a local beer dinner beginning at 6:00 PM. Stephen Tuzeneu, a Certified Cicerone and the Craft/Specialty Manager at Brown Distributing, will walk you through great beer and food pairings throughout the evening. Tickets are $75 and include a welcome beer, five courses paired with a local brew, tax and gratuity. Menu available here.

Location change! This Friday, the beloved Food Cart Court will move from the parking lot of the Virginia Historical Society to the floodwall in Shockoe Bottom. From 6pm to 9pm you can enjoy dinner from Boka Tako Truck, Curbside Creations Food Truck, Dressed & Pressed gourmet mobile food truck, Flynn’s Foods, Mister Softee Richmond VA, Rooster Cart, RVA Vegan, and Sustenance Food Truck.
